Roast Pork Tenderloin
Roast Pork Tenderloin is an easy dinner. Made with 1 tsp. dried whole rosemary, crushed, 1 tsp. dried whole thyme, 1 large clove garlic, minced, 2 (1 1/2 to 2 lb.) pork tenderloins and 1/4 c. butter, melted,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. Combine herbs and garlic; set aside.
Brush tenderloins with butter and roll in herb mixture, coating evenly.
Place tenderloins, fat side up, on a rack in a shallow roasting pan. Insert meat thermometer into thickest part of tenderloin, making sure thermometer does not touch fat.
Drizzle any remaining butter over meat.
Bake at 375Β° for 1 hour to 1 hour and 15 minutes.
